| Manufacturer | Allen Bradley |
|---|---|
| Product Type | AC Drive |
| Product Line | PowerFlex 70 |
| Part Number | 20AD1P1A0AYYANC1 |
| Weight | 10.00 lbs (4.54 kg) |
| Operating Voltage | 480 VAC |
| Number of Phases | 3-phase |
| Frequency Rating | 50/60 Hz |
| ND Current Rating | 1.1 A |
| Power Output (kW) | 0.37 kW |
| Power Output (HP) | 0.5 HP |
| Frame Size | A |
| Enclosure | IP20, NEMA 1 |
| HMI Module | Blank Cover |
| Brake IGBT | Yes |
| Internal Brake Resistor | Yes |
| Communication Slot | None |
| Control Type | Enhanced (No Safe-Off) |
| Feedback Option | Encoder, 12V/5V |
The Allen Bradley model 20AD1P1A0AYYANC1 is a specialized AC drive for industrial operation, specifically designed for three-phase input. It functions effectively at an operating voltage of 480 VAC and is rated to handle currents up to 1.1 A. This compact drive has a 0.37 kW output, translating to 0.5 HP, making it suitable for various applications.
Constructed in frame size A, the drive features an enclosure rated IP20, which falls under NEMA 1 specifications, suitable for non-harsh environments. The human-machine interface (HMI) has a blank cover, indicating a simplified design without additional interface elements.
In terms of operational capabilities, the drive includes a built-in IGBT for braking functions, along with an internal brake resistor facilitating smooth stopping of the motor. While equipped with an enhanced control type, it does not include a Safe-Off feature. Notably, the system allows for feedback via encoders with alternating 12V and 5V options, ensuring accurate position and performance monitoring throughout its operation. Communication slots are not included in this model, streamlining its design for straightforward integration into existing systems.
